Zilei Wang is a scholar working on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ition, Artificial Intelligence and Electrical and Electronic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Zilei Wang has authored 152 papers receiving a total of 4.2k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 71 papers in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ition, 44 papers in Artificial Intelligence and 40 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ering. Recurrent topics in Zilei Wang's work include Domain Adaptation and Few-Shot Learning (30 papers), Multimodal Machine Learning Applications (24 papers) and Silicon and Solar Cell Technologies (19 papers). Zilei Wang is often cited by papers focused on Domain Adaptation and Few-Shot Learning (30 papers), Multimodal Machine Learning Applications (24 papers) and Silicon and Solar Cell Technologies (19 papers). Zilei Wang coll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and Singapore. Zilei Wang's co-authors include Saihui Hou, Dahua Lin, Xinyu Pan, Chen Change Loy, Shanglong Peng, Yuxiang Wen, Guozhong Cao, Tieniu Tan, Tianfeng Qin and Deyan He and has published in prestigious journ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, IEEE Transactions on Pattern Analysis and Machine Intelligence and Advanced Functional Materials.
